Lets compare vitamin content per 100 grams of Sunflower Seeds vs Kanpyo:
Dried Sunflower Seed Kernels have more Vitamin B1, 8.1 times more Vitamin B2, 2.9 times more Vitamin B3, 2.5 times more Vitamin B6, 3.7 times more Vitamin B9 and 7 times more Vitamin C than Dried gourd strips.
While Dried gourd strips contain 2.3 times more Vitamin B5 than Dried Sunflower Seed Kernels.
Both Dried Sunflower Seed Kernels as well as Dried gourd strips have insufficient amounts of Vitamin B12 and Vitamin D in 100 g.
Comparing minerals per 100 grams for Sunflower Seeds vs Kanpyo:
Dried Sunflower Seed Kernels have 4.2 times more Copper, 2.6 times more Magnesium, 1.7 times more Manganese, 3.5 times more Phosphorus and 20.4 times more Selenium than Dried gourd strips.
While Dried gourd strips contain 3.6 times more Calcium, 2.5 times more Potassium and 1.7 times more Sodium than Dried Sunflower Seed Kernels.
Both Dried Sunflower Seed Kernels and Dried gourd strips have similar amounts of Iron and Zinc per 100 g.
Comparison of macro-nutrients per 100 grams:
Dried Sunflower Seed Kernels have 2.3 times more Energy, 91.9 times more Fat, 99 times more Saturated Fat, 94.5 times more Omega 6 and 2.4 times more Protein than Dried gourd strips.
While Dried gourd strips contain 3.3 times more Carbohydrate than Dried Sunflower Seed Kernels.
Both Dried Sunflower Seed Kernels and Dried gourd strips have similar amounts of Fiber per 100 g.
Both Dried Sunflower Seed Kernels as well as Dried gourd strips have insufficient amounts of Cholesterol, Glucose and Sucrose in 100 g.
